Output 639224e92732f4c24ce2dfd75b0e9d7688f6c6d6b5013e4d4ead912526a98aad:0

value
3466876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9cb267e8aa62e5e53f18aa9ba6fb63456460942 OP_EQUAL
address
3JdQJAfVRVo8xvR4C5eVHjRbJb8zsKrpCo
transaction
639224e92732f4c24ce2dfd75b0e9d7688f6c6d6b5013e4d4ead912526a98aad
spent
true